The Arthritis Score in 10968, Piermont, New York is 97 out of 100 when comparing 34,000 ZIP Codes in the United States.

79.48 percent of the population in 10968 drive to work alone. 5.40 percent of the people take some form of public transportation like the bus or the train to work. Approximately 47.88 percent of the residents get to work in less than 30 minutes. 14.76 percent of the residents in 10968 get to work in more than 60 minutes. The average household size is approximately 1.74 members with about 1.74 cars available per household.

An estimate of 98.46 percent of the residents in 10968 has some form of health insurance. 31.17 percent of the residents have some type of public health insurance like Medicare, Medicaid, Veterans Affairs (VA), or TRICARE. About 84.04 percent of the residents have private health insurance, either through their employer or direct purchase.

A resident in 10968 would have to travel an average of 3.94 miles to reach the nearest hospital with an emergency room, Nyack Hospital . In a 20-mile radius, there are 0 healthcare providers accessible to residents in 10968, Piermont, New York.

As of , an estimate of 2,525 residents live in 10968 with a median age of 52.1 years. 11.41 percent of the population is under the age of 18, and 21.35 percent of the population is at least 65 years of age. 36.30 percent of the residents in 10968 is currently married, and 24.49 percent of the population has never been married.

The monthly median household income in 10968 is $12,886.00. The monthly median housing costs for residents in 10968 is approximately $2,251. The median household spends about 17.47 percent of their income on housing.
